What Makes a Fitness Tracker Lightweight and Why Is It Important?
A lightweight fitness tracker is characterized by its design and materials, which contribute to both comfort and usability during physical activities.
- Material: Lightweight fitness trackers are often made from materials such as silicone, plastic, or lightweight metals like aluminum. These materials not only reduce the overall weight of the device but also enhance comfort, allowing users to wear them for extended periods without discomfort.
- Design: The design of a lightweight fitness tracker typically features a slim profile and minimal bulk. This ergonomic design is crucial for ensuring that the device does not interfere with movement during workouts or daily activities, making it ideal for users who engage in various physical exercises.
- Battery Efficiency: Many lightweight fitness trackers utilize efficient, compact batteries that provide long-lasting power without adding significant weight. This is important because it allows users to track their fitness metrics over extended periods without needing frequent recharges, thus enhancing the convenience of the device.
- Functionality: Despite being lightweight, these trackers often pack advanced features such as heart rate monitoring, GPS, and activity tracking. The ability to combine these functionalities in a lightweight design makes them appealing to fitness enthusiasts who seek both performance and comfort.
- Wearability: A lightweight tracker is designed to be less intrusive, allowing users to wear it throughout the day, including during sleep. This constant wearability is essential for accurate tracking of daily activities, sleep patterns, and overall health monitoring.

What Are the Leading Lightweight Fitness Trackers Available Today?
The leading lightweight fitness trackers available today include:
- Fitbit Inspire 3: The Fitbit Inspire 3 is designed for comfort and ease of use, featuring a slim profile and a vibrant display. It tracks various activities, including steps, heart rate, and sleep patterns, while offering a battery life of up to 10 days, making it ideal for those who want a reliable yet unobtrusive fitness companion.
- Xiaomi Mi Band 7: The Xiaomi Mi Band 7 is known for its affordability and lightweight design, providing a host of features such as heart rate monitoring, sleep tracking, and a bright AMOLED display. With a battery life that can last up to two weeks on a single charge, it appeals to budget-conscious consumers looking for robust functionality without bulk.
- Garmin Vivosmart 5: The Garmin Vivosmart 5 combines sleek aesthetics with advanced fitness tracking capabilities, including stress tracking and fitness age metrics. Its lightweight and water-resistant design makes it suitable for both everyday wear and rigorous workouts, while the battery can last up to seven days, ensuring it keeps up with an active lifestyle.
- Samsung Galaxy Fit 2: The Samsung Galaxy Fit 2 offers a lightweight design with a large AMOLED display, allowing users to easily view notifications and track their fitness goals. It includes features like sleep tracking and multiple workout modes, with a battery life of up to 15 days, making it an excellent choice for those who prioritize both style and functionality.
- WHOOP Strap 3.0: The WHOOP Strap 3.0 is a unique fitness tracker that emphasizes recovery and performance monitoring, providing insights into strain and sleep quality. Its lightweight design is complemented by a subscription model that gives users access to personalized coaching, making it ideal for serious athletes looking to optimize their training regimens.

What Are Common User Mistakes to Avoid When Using Fitness Trackers?
Common user mistakes when using fitness trackers can hinder effectiveness and lead to inaccurate data.
- Inaccurate Data Input: Many users neglect to input their personal data such as age, weight, height, and fitness level, which are crucial for accurate tracking. Without this information, the tracker cannot provide personalized metrics or tailored recommendations, leading to misguided conclusions about fitness progress.
- Ignoring Calibration: Some fitness trackers require calibration for accurate readings, particularly for metrics like heart rate and stride length. Failing to calibrate the device can result in erroneous step counts and activity levels, undermining the reliability of the data.
- Overlooking Regular Updates: Fitness trackers often have firmware updates that improve functionality and fix bugs. Users who ignore these updates may miss out on enhanced features or important fixes that could improve the accuracy and performance of their device.
- Inconsistent Wear: To achieve the best results, users should wear their fitness tracker consistently. Taking it off frequently can lead to incomplete data and a lack of insight into daily activity levels, making it difficult to gauge overall fitness progress.
- Neglecting App Integration: Many fitness trackers sync with companion apps that provide detailed insights and trends. Users who do not engage with these apps miss out on valuable analysis and motivation tools that can enhance their fitness journey.
- Setting Unrealistic Goals: Users often set overly ambitious fitness goals based on the data from their trackers without considering their current fitness level. This can lead to frustration and discouragement when goals are not met, rather than fostering a gradual and sustainable improvement in fitness.
- Failing to Charge Regularly: A common oversight is neglecting to keep the device charged, leading to missed tracking opportunities. Regularly checking battery levels and charging the tracker ensures that users can consistently monitor their activity and health metrics without interruption.
